

On November 21, 2025, Cardano's blockchain experienced a significant technical disruption when a deliberately crafted malformed transaction exploited an overlooked deserialization bug in the network's validation system. This transaction created a divergence between newer and older node versions, causing them to disagree on transaction validity. The network subsequently split into two separate chains—one labeled "poisoned" and the other "healthy"—as block producers inadvertently built blocks on different branches.
The incident triggered immediate market reaction, with ADA token price declining by 6% as investors responded to the network instability. Staking pools and exchanges faced temporary operational chaos during the split period. However, Cardano's development teams from Input Output Global, the Cardano Foundation, Intersect, and EMURGO coordinated a rapid emergency response, releasing patched node software within approximately three hours. Network operators were instructed to upgrade to the patched versions, enabling the network to successfully reconverge onto a single canonical chain.
The Intersect governance body confirmed that no user funds were lost during the incident, and most retail wallets remained unaffected despite the temporary network bifurcation. This event demonstrated that while the network faced a brief crisis, the coordinated response mechanisms proved effective in restoring stability and maintaining the integrity of user assets on the platform.
Cardano experienced a significant technical crisis when a malformed transaction created using AI-generated commands triggered an unprecedented chain split. The incident occurred when newer node versions accepted a transaction that older nodes rejected, causing the network to diverge into two separate chains. One chain contained the "poisoned" transaction while the other maintained normal operations, disrupting network consensus and validator coordination.
The attacker leveraged an AI tool to generate terminal commands that created the malformed delegation transaction, exploiting a known vulnerability in Cardano's validation logic. This technical miscalculation between node versions revealed a critical gap in the network's upgrade compatibility mechanisms. According to Intersect's post-mortem analysis, the divergence persisted until an emergency patch was deployed network-wide, requiring coordinated action from block producers to restore consensus.
